I suffered a system volume/HDD failure, and I'm in the process of recovering from that. I setup my TS-251+ with two different simple volumes, where one is used as system volume (and my DATA) and the other is purely used as backup.
So I replaced the system volume/HDD, inserted the backup volume and now need to recover my data. I'd like to recover my HBS3 backup job, which contained multiple pairs from the destination (=the backup), and apparently it should be possible to do that (here's the link). But it seems that the UI changed, and it is now called relinking? but whichever destination I pick it says "The destination backup does not support relinking", as you can see in the images below.
I can setup the backup job from scratch, but then it'll just, redundantly, copy over all the data (TBs of data) from the source to the destination, which is completly pointless since I just recovered that data. I'm trying to avoid that.
